Regarded as one of the most terrifying video games ever, Outlast first shook the gaming world in 2013. Its sudden rise to fame was largely fueled by the influential YouTube Let's Play community. With just one sequel under its belt, Outlast is now gearing up for the full release of a multiplayer prequel spinoff, The Outlast Trials.

As anticipation builds for this new game, and with positive early reviews already circulating, Outlast is back in the spotlight. This resurgence offers a perfect opening for a potential collaboration between Dead by Daylight and Outlast. Having previously partnered with Resident Evil and Alan Wake, Dead by Daylight seems primed for its next gaming crossover, making an Outlast DLC a tantalizing prospect.

Possibilities for Outlast-Inspired Killers

The Outlast series boasts a plethora of horrifying adversaries, perfect candidates for inclusion as Killers in a potential Dead by Daylight and Outlast crossover DLC. A standout choice would be the imposing Chris Walker, a formidable presence in Mount Massive known for his strength and tenacity. His abilities in Dead by Daylight could involve swift captures or heightened senses for tracking Survivors.

Another compelling option for the crossover would be Richard Trager, a memorable antagonist wielding bone shears. A Dead by Daylight iteration of Trager could feature abilities centered around his iconic weapon, adding a chilling dimension to gameplay.

Adapting Outlast's Unique Perspective

A distinctive feature of the Outlast series is its first-person night-vision view. Integrating this aspect into Dead by Daylight would be a significant undertaking, but the impact could be game-changing. While altering gameplay mechanics can be daunting, introducing a new perspective could inject fresh terror into the experience, particularly for Survivors.

Shifting Survivors to a first-person view with a night-vision filter could revolutionize the fear factor in Dead by Daylight, albeit requiring substantial effort for new animations and mechanics.
